Inside My Mind
Rhonda Lee Nelson-Emery 1970 (Fairfax virginia)
Inside My Mind
Copyright Rhonda Neson-Emery
You think you know whats in my mind. I promise you this,I 'm one of a kind.
God has bred me.for.the things I've endured.
One less abused with an extention cord.
I'm not looking for any sympathy cause, someone out there has it worse then me.
Their minds are not able to handle their pain,often losing themselves. They go completely insane.
Beaten Burned,Raped and Abused, but make No mistake. I am NOT confused!
It's up to us who we will be. Abuse to abuse? That's not how I see!
It's not passed on with that much ease, often confused as a family disease.
But Inside Mind, where the walls could fall. All must do is give God a call.
About this poem
This is My life, but it doesn't define me.
